Originally Posted by glitch

Okay, sometimes the soft shell occurs when you have too many views and not enough clicks, thats the way its stated at the dragon cave, and Ive found it to be very true, the rare ones are the silver, gold, paper, splits are not so rare at the moment and the dino's are on the semi rare list! Yoshi is not available to get anymore due to copywrite issues!

Rather than killing your egg if you have to get rid of it, abandon it that way someone else has the opportunity to take it and raise it and get it healthy! White eggs are also rare! I have several eggs right now and many dragons if you guys want to take a look its under my siggy! Any questions you have about the dragons feel free to pm me! When you get a soft shell you should hide it for a while to harden it up again, and also, the first day after getting an egg are critical, the same with the first day they hatch! Those are the days you are most likely to come on and found they have passed away! I killed my first 4 eggs by not getting them the views they needed and have not killed one since, if anyone wants to pm me their hatchlings and eggs I will gladly click on them!

Also, with my silver when it was an egg, someone clicked on it and kept hitting refresh, so I had over 600 views and only 38 clicks, thats when I had to hide it, because some people will intentionally murder your rare eggs and hatchlings! If you have more clicks that you do views your egg will get a soft shell too...

Originally Posted by menagerie mama

I seem to be confused (there's a shocker). I thought someone said if I put my scroll up for people to click on, it was considered a "view," and better for the eggs, as opposed to a "click" that you get if I put my egg out for people to click, and "clicks" are not as good? I think I need to do more studying...
Not everyone is going to click on your link to view your eggs. If you attach an egg to your siggy everyone views the egg every time they read your post but they don't necessarily click on the egg. It's the views that are important.

Out of ten people who may see your egg today, you may get 1 person o curious to actually click on the egg. So out of 10 people you have 10 views and 1 click.

I will try to explain it this way.

I see your purple egg in your siggy today. That counts as 1 view and 1 unique view. I see it again in later it counts as 2 views but no unique views because every IP address is only counted once. If I than click on your purple egg it counts as 1 click.

Hope that helps.
